Actors Julie Harris and Robert Redford, singers Tony Bennett and Tina Turner, and ballerina-teacher Suzanne Farrell will receive Kennedy Center Honors this winter, the performing arts center announced Tuesday.
“We honor five extraordinary American artists whose unique and abundant contributions to our culture have transformed our lives,” said Stephen A. Schwarzman, chairman of the John F. Kennedy Center for the Performing Arts.
Recipients of the 28th annual honors will be recognized at a gala performance at the Kennedy Center on Dec. 4, to be attended by President Bush and first lady Laura Bush. CBS will broadcast the gala later in December.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ice will host the honorees at a State Department dinner on Dec. 3.
